Being Not Doing

Image

“In Your presence is fullness of Joy; In your right hand there are pleasures for evermore”. Psalm 16:11

God so wants us to enjoy Him. A funny thought when we so often have so many demands and expectations on our lives. Above everything else He wants us to enjoy Him, because He loves us. He loves us so much.

We actually don’t have to do anything to earn or keep that love. He just loves us.

We simply need to turn our face towards Him and let ourselves experience that Love, to be in His love.

I remember years ago when we had just had our first beautiful baby girl Anna and I was wondering how to do everything and be everything.

God spoke to me and said,  “Just “be” instead of do” “Being rather than doing!” What a relief that was. God didn’t expect me to do anything just simply to be, to be in His presence, to be full in Him, to be joyful, to be happy.

Often when I am busy I will hear those words whispered again. “Just be, don’t do”. When I take notice and stop “doing”, then everything that needs to happen in my world flows. When I take my attention off Him and get into striving and doing, I always end up in a “pickle”. 

We so need to practice just “being”, being in God’s presence, being in Him, knowing that we are already “in Him, connected  and having fullness of life in Jesus.” Col 2:10. 

Spending today “Being” in His presence where fullness of joy is.
